Prayer: Writ Petition filed under Article 226 of the Constitution of India, praying to issue a Writ of Certiorarified Mandamus to call for the records relating to the Impugned order dated 29.01.2015 passed by the 5th respondent issuing a transfer certificate as discontinue of studies of the petitioner and to quash the same and consequently direct the 5th respondent to permit the petitioner to complete the higher secondary course.

O R D E R
Heard Mr.C.Prabakaran, learned counsel for the petitioner and Mr.G.Nagarajan, learned counsel for first and second respondents and Ms.P.Rajalakshmi, learned Government Advocate for third and fourth respondents.
2. When the case came up for hearing on 05.02.2015, this Court directed the learned counsel for the petitioner to serve notice on the respondents. Accordingly, notice has been served and the learned counsel for the respondents have appeared. The principal of the School is also present in the Court and it is submitted that the 5th respondent, School will permit the student to write the examination provided the entire school fee payable by the petitioner is paid. It appears that there is some allegation against the petitioner with regard to the thieving of petty material etc., However, this issue need not be gone into, in the light of the stand taken by the fourth and fifth respondents permitting the petitioner to write examination.
However, it is pointed out by the learned counsel for CBSE that the centre of examination will be normally a different Institution. Therefore, the 5th respondent should have no apprehension at all. 3.Accordingly, there will be a direction to the petitioner to pay the entire fees payable by the petitioner and on payment of such fees, hall ticket will be issued by the 5th respondent and the petitioner would be entitled to attend Plus two examination, practical and theory examinations commencing from 14.02.2015. It is made clear the that the fees will have to be paid well in advance. It is also made clear that the first and second respondents are not proper necessary party in the Writ Petition, however, in order to assist the Court, the learned counsel for the first and second respondents were directed to accept notice.
With the above observation, this Writ petition is disposed of. Consequently, connected miscellaneous petitions are closed. No costs. -s/d- Assistant Registrar(CSII) Dated:11/2/2015 True Copy Sub-Assistant Registrar ssd To
